Maintain the operational integrity of your Mustang Survival inflatable Personal Flotation Device (PFD) after accidental or intentional deployment with this specific re-arm kit. This kit contains a 33-gram CO2 cylinder and a bobbin, crucial components for both automatic and manual inflation systems. How often should I replace the bobbin in my automatic inflatable PFD?
The bobbin in an automatic inflatable PFD should be replaced every time the PFD is re-armed after deployment, as it is designed to activate once and is not intended for reuse. Regular inspection according to the PFD manual is also recommended.

Can I use a re-arm kit from a different brand with my Mustang inflatable PFD?
It is strongly recommended to only use Mustang Survival re-arm kits with Mustang Survival inflatable PFDs. Using kits from other brands may result in improper function, failure to inflate, or voiding the PFD's warranty.
What Mustang Survival PFD models is this re-arm kit compatible with?
This re-arm kit is compatible with a wide range of Mustang Survival PFD models, including MD2051, MD2053, MD2981, MD2085, MD2087, MD2983, MD2951, MD2953, MD3051, MD3052, MD3053, MD3054, MD3071, MD3075, MD3081, MD3082, MD3083, MD3084, MD3085, and MD3087.
